ZEN-3694
Synonym(s): BET-IN-19
- CAS No.: 1643947-30-1
- Formula:C19H19N5O
- Molecular Weight:333.39
IUPAC Name: 1-benzyl-6-(3,5-dimethylisoxazol-4-yl)-N-methyl-1H-imidazo[4,5-b]pyridin-2-amine
InChIKey: VUFGOHIETLJZRG-UHFFFAOYSA-N
SMILES: CNC1=NC(N=CC(C2=C(C)ON=C2C)=C3)=C3N1CC4=CC=CC=C4
Biological Activity: ZEN-3694 (BET-IN-19) is an orally active BET inhibitor. ZEN-3694 regulates the function of BET proteins, thereby downregulating pathways involved in cell cycle regulation, ER signaling, AR signaling, AR splice variants, MYC, GR, cell growth, inflammation, and cellular immune responses. ZEN-3694 inhibits proliferation, induces apoptosis, reverses the upregulation of CDK6 and CCND1, restores cell cycle arrest, and inhibits CDK6 via miR-34a-5p. ZEN-3694 can be used in research related to HER2 breast cancer and metastatic castration-resistant prostate cancer[1][2][3].
